_Événement PBT APMRESUMEAUTOMATIC
Notifie les applications que le système reprend du mode veille ou veille prolongée. Cet événement est remis chaque fois que le système reprend et n’indique pas si un utilisateur est présent.
Une fenêtre reçoit cet événement par le biais du message WM _ POWERBROADCAST . Les paramètres wParam et lParam sont définis comme suit.
Notes
dans Windows 10 versions 1507 ou ultérieures, si le système quitte le mode veille uniquement pour entrer immédiatement en veille prolongée, cet événement n’est pas remis. Un message WM _ POWERBROADCAST n’est pas envoyé dans ce cas.
LRESULT
CALLBACK
WindowProc( HWND hwnd, // handle to window
UINT uMsg, // WM_POWERBROADCAST
WPARAM wParam, // PBT_APMRESUMEAUTOMATIC
LPARAM lParam); // zero
Paramètres
-
HWND
-
Handle de fenêtre.
- *uMsg*
-
Valeur Signification - WM _ POWERBROADCAST
- 536 (0x218)
Identificateur du message. - *wParam*
-
Valeur Signification - PBT _ APMRESUMEAUTOMATIC
- 18 (0x12)
Identificateur d’événement. -
lParam
-
Réservé doit être égal à zéro.
Valeur de retour
Pas de valeur de retour.
Notes
Si le système détecte une activité utilisateur après avoir diffusé PBT _ APMRESUMEAUTOMATIC, il diffuse un événement PBT _ APMRESUMESUSPEND pour permettre aux applications de savoir qu’elles peuvent reprendre une interaction complète avec l’utilisateur.
Configuration requise
| Condition requise | Valeur |
|---|---|
| Client minimal pris en charge |
Windows [Applications de bureau XP uniquement] |
| Serveur minimal pris en charge |
Windows Serveur 2003 [ applications de bureau uniquement] |
| En-tête |
|